Hyper-V synthetic SCSI devices do not support the MAINTENANCE_IN SCSI
command, so scsi_report_opcode() always fails, resulting in messages like
this:
hv_storvsc <guid>: tag#205 cmd 0xa3 status: scsi 0x2 srb 0x86 hv 0xc0000001
The recently added support for command duration limits calls
scsi_report_opcode() four times as each device comes online, which
significantly increases the number of messages logged in a system with many
disks.
Fix the problem by always marking Hyper-V synthetic SCSI devices as not
supporting scsi_report_opcode(). With this setting, the MAINTENANCE_IN SCSI
command is not issued and no messages are logged.

In the last step of the EEH recovery process, the EEH driver calls into
bnx2x_io_resume() to re-initialize the NIC hardware via the function
bnx2x_nic_load(). If an error occurs during bnx2x_nic_load(), OS and
hardware resources are released and an error code is returned to the
caller. When called from bnx2x_io_resume(), the return code is ignored
and the network interface is brought up unconditionally. Later attempts
to send a packet via this interface result in a page fault due to a null
pointer reference.
This patch checks the return code of bnx2x_nic_load(), prints an error
message if necessary, and does not enable the interface.

As &qedi_percpu->p_work_lock is acquired by hard IRQ qedi_msix_handler(),
other acquisitions of the same lock under process context should disable
IRQ, otherwise deadlock could happen if the IRQ preempts the execution
while the lock is held in process context on the same CPU.
qedi_cpu_offline() is one such function which acquires the lock in process
context.
[Deadlock Scenario]
qedi_cpu_offline()
->spin_lock(&p->p_work_lock)
<irq>
->qedi_msix_handler()
->edi_process_completions()
->spin_lock_irqsave(&p->p_work_lock, flags); (deadlock here)
This flaw was found by an experimental static analysis tool I am developing
for IRQ-related deadlocks.
The tentative patch fix the potential deadlock by spin_lock_irqsave()
under process context.

Using brcmfmac with 6.5-rc3 on a brcmfmac43241b4-sdio triggers
a backtrace caused by the following field-spanning warning:
memcpy: detected field-spanning write (size 120) of single field
"¶ms_le->channel_list[0]" at
drivers/net/wireless/broadcom/brcm80211/brcmfmac/cfg80211.c:1072 (size 2)
The driver still works after this warning. The warning was introduced by the
new field-spanning write checks which were enabled recently.
Fix this by replacing the channel_list[1] declaration at the end of
the struct with a flexible array declaration.
Most users of struct brcmf_scan_params_le calculate the size to alloc
using the size of the non flex-array part of the struct + needed extra
space, so they do not care about sizeof(struct brcmf_scan_params_le).
brcmf_notify_escan_complete() however uses the struct on the stack,
expecting there to be room for at least 1 entry in the channel-list
to store the special -1 abort channel-id.
To make this work use an anonymous union with a padding member
added + the actual channel_list flexible array.

It is incorrect in python to compare integer values using the "is" keyword.
The "is" keyword in python is used to compare references to two objects,
not their values. Newer version of python3 (version 3.8) throws a warning
when such incorrect comparison is made. For value comparison, "==" should
be used.
Fix this in the code and suppress the following warning:
/usr/sbin/vmbus_testing:167: SyntaxWarning: "is" with a literal. Did you mean "=="?

If the current task fails the check for the queried capability via
`capable(CAP_SYS_ADMIN)` LSMs like SELinux generate a denial message.
Issuing such denial messages unnecessarily can lead to a policy author
granting more privileges to a subject than needed to silence them.
Reorder CAP_SYS_ADMIN checks after the check whether the operation is
actually privileged.

Commit db1d1e8b98 ("IMA: use vfs_getattr_nosec to get the i_version")
partially closed an IMA integrity issue when directly modifying a file
on the lower filesystem. If the overlay file is first opened by a user
and later the lower backing file is modified by root, but the extended
attribute is NOT updated, the signature validation succeeds with the old
original signature.
Update the super_block s_iflags to SB_I_IMA_UNVERIFIABLE_SIGNATURE to
force signature reevaluation on every file access until a fine grained
solution can be found.

The DASD device driver has a function to requeue requests to the
blocklayer.
This function is used in various cases when basic settings for the device
have to be changed like High Performance Ficon related parameters or copy
pair settings.
The functions iterates over the device->ccw_queue and also removes the
requests from the block->ccw_queue.
In case the device is started on an alias device instead of the base
device it might be removed from the block->ccw_queue without having it
canceled properly before. This might lead to a hanging device since the
request is no longer on a queue and can not be handled properly.
Fix by iterating over the block->ccw_queue instead of the
device->ccw_queue. This will take care of all blocklayer related requests
and handle them on all associated DASD devices.

If a DASD request fails an error recovery procedure (ERP) request might
be built as a copy of the original request to do error recovery.
The ERP request gets a number of retries assigned.
This number is always 256 no matter what other value might have been set
for the original request. This is not what is expected when a user
specifies a certain amount of retries for the device via sysfs.
Correctly use the number of retries of the original request for ERP
requests.
